Abstract

Correlacionar un registro medido y un registro pronosticado. Al menos algunas de las realizaciones ilustrativas son métodos que incluyen: trazar valores del registro medido con respecto a un eje de coordenadas y un eje de abscisas y realizar el trazado en un primer panel; trazar valores del registro pronosticado con respecto al eje de coordenadas y el eje de abscisas; seleccionar un punto de inflexión del registro pronosticado; mover la posición horizontal del punto de inflexión en relación con el registro medido en respuesta al dispositivo de señalización; cambiar la inclinación de la menos una superficie modelada en un modelo estructural en base a la ubicación relativa del punto de inflexión; volver a calcular el registro pronosticado en base al cambio de la inclinación, en donde el nuevo cálculo crea un registro pronosticado modificado; y luego trazar el registro pronosticado modificado. En algunos casos, el método de la reivindicación 1 también puede incluir agregar un punto fijo X, Y, Z en la al menos una superficie modelada en base a la ubicación del punto de inflexión.
